Name: Sloan

Gender: Male

Age: 4 years

Breed: Catahoula

Weight: 60lbs

Disability: Deaf

Dogs: yes

Cats: yes

Kids: yes

Socialization/training: Sloan knows the sign for sit, down, shake, come, no, in, place, and he knows how to jump an agility hurdle and go through a tunnel. He loves learning new things. He is very well socialized with other people and is learning to sit politely to greet new people and not jump up. He was a hot commodity with the ladies at the vets office and knew how to turn on the charm. If you bend down to say hello to him, even for the first time meeting him, he tends to want to crawl right into your lap. He is currently 1 of 5 other dogs in his foster home and lives with 3 cats. Zero issues with either, he is pretty indifferent to the cats and typically doesn’t even offer to chase them if they run. Sloan has lived in a home with a doggie door before and knows how to use one. Sloan would probably be suited better for more sturdier children. Sloan has good house manners and typically needs little direction inside the home. Sloan is better suited in a crate if you leave. He plays with dogs that will play with him and is respectful around older dogs or dogs who aren’t as playful. He has shown no resource guarding tendencies in his foster home. He does have a habit of trying to suckle fleece blankets and should be promptly redirected from doing so. 

Crate trained: Sloan is crate trained. He is currently fed all his meals in his crate, as are all the other dogs in the home he lives in. He will happily go in there and settles down fairly quickly with most times, zero protesting. It is unknown how he would do outside of his crate when people aren’t home. Expect some regression as he moves to a new environment and is testing boundaries/settling in. Sloan is currently crated for 8-10 hours with no issues.

Leash trained: Yes! He was surrendered to our rescue for being hard to manage on a leash and being reactive to other dogs on walks but with training he has graduated from those nuisance behaviors and now composes himself like a total gentleman. He will need a confident handler ready to take over that roll so he has confidence in his human for guidance. He is friendly and happy to meet people he sees out and about. He loves getting to get out and explore. He would make a great hiking buddy.

Activity Level: Sloan has a moderate energy level. He could spend hours hanging out with other dogs and playing chase or WWE wrestling with any dogs that will play with him. Sometimes he does have to be reminded to be gentle. A home with at least one other dog, playful or not, would be preferred. Once inside, he loves to work on his obedience or entertain himself by chewing on bones next to his people on the couch.

Fence: Sloan will need a fenced in yard for his next home. He loves nothing more than to get outside and check his perimeters and make sure everything is in good working order. He is watchful of neighbors or things in his environment that are not in the normal and will alert you of them, but is not a nuisance barker. Sloan is very respectful of his 5 foot chain link fence he currently has at his foster home and does not try to dig under or escape. He may be an okay candidate for an invisible fence system in a country setting.

Behavior: Sloan is such an affectionate, playful, goofy, and eager to please dog. He is always sure to have his charm turned all the way up. Sloan has never had a bad day and is always happy to just be here. He would be a good bro dog and even a good dog for the first time deaf dog owner. Whoever ends up with him will be incredibly blessed. Sloan really loves to learn and flourishes on guidance and direction from his humans. It would be ideal for a new family to enroll in some entry level obedience courses with him so that you too can learn to work with this boy so he can continue to flourish into the dog with so much potential we know he has!
